## Part 1 – Arriving in the U.S. 🇺🇸
**Robert (narrating):**
I arrived in Los Angeles in the late 80’s. *(Past Simple)*
👉 En español: *Llegué a Los Ángeles a finales de los años 80.*
I didn’t speak English at all. *(Past Simple, negative)*
👉 *No hablaba inglés para nada.*
I remember my first day at Jordan Junior High School in La Habra, California.
I was nervous, and I felt lost. *(Past Simple + Past Continuous)*
👉 *Estaba nervioso y me sentía perdido.*
But then, my teacher, Ms. Shawn, helped me every day. *(Past Simple)*
👉 *Pero luego mi profesora, Ms. Shawn, me ayudaba todos los días.*
**Grammar Note 📝**
* *Past Simple*: acciones terminadas en el pasado → *I arrived, I didn’t speak, she helped.*
* *Past Continuous*: acciones en progreso en el pasado → *I was nervous, I was feeling lost.*

## Part 2 – Learning English with Ms. Shawn 📚
**Robert (narrating):**
Ms. Shawn always encouraged me. *(Past Simple)*
👉 *Ms. Shawn siempre me animaba.*
She would say: “Robert, you can do it!” *(Would for past habits)*
👉 *Ella decía: “¡Robert, tú puedes hacerlo!”*
If I hadn’t had her support, I might have given up. *(Third Conditional + Past Modal)*
👉 *Si no hubiera tenido su apoyo, quizá me habría rendido.*
**Grammar Note 📝**
* *Would*: para hábitos en el pasado.
* *Third Conditional*: *If + Past Perfect → would have / might have*.
